The first winner of a national MYOB Awesome Service Awards epitomizes the values associated with fantastic customer service, as Aucklander Sandra Moorhead explains: 

"I am a Dive Leader originally from the UK but now a proud Kiwi, with 7 years diving experience.   Many of my diving friends from the UK visit me in NZ, and I always take them to dive the Poor Knights Islands.  

We usually dive with Dive Tutukaka, but one particular day we had booked with another dive operator, who let us down and cancelled the trip 5 minutes before we were due to set off, leaving us stranded on Tutukaka Wharf with our dive kit and no boat.  

So we raced up to Dive Tutukaka to see if they could take us out diving instead.  Their boat was full and about to set off, but Evan made the decision to put another boat on for us at the drop of a hat.  He called an off duty staff member, who got out of bed and joined the crew at a moment's notice, freeing up Evan to skipper another boat just for us. 

 I was a bit concerned as we hadn't brought any lunch with us, and there's nothing worse than diving hungry.  Evan must have read my mind, as his next action was to ask if we wanted lunch provided, and also enquire as to whether there were any special dietary requirements. Hence in the space of five minutes, he not only organised a dive boat for the five of us, but ensured we would have a comfortable day with all of our needs anticipated and met. 

As always at the Poor Knights, the diving was awesome.  The atmosphere on the boat was lovely and relaxed, with Evan helping us to kit up as required, and when we were back on board the boat, offering and making us soups and tea and coffee as required. 

As an example of nothing being too much trouble, our boat ran out of Pea and Ham soup, so Evan radio-ed the other Dive Tutukaka boat to see if they had any, launched a tender, and got some more! 

It was a spectacular day, entirely down to Evan's good sense and amazing customer service. In my experience, nothing is ever too much trouble for Dive!Tutukaka. They are always awesome, and Evan epitomized this service ethic that day". 

Congratulations to Evan Barclay of Dive!Tukukaka: A worthy MYOB Awesome Service Award winner.
